The Connection Between Blink Rate and Meibomian Gland Dysfunction

Meibomian gland dysfunction (MGD) is a common underlying cause of dry eye syndrome. It’s characterized by blockages or abnormalities in the meibomian glands, which produce meibum, the oily substance that helps to lubricate and protect the eyes. When the meibomian glands don’t function properly, it can disrupt the tear film’s balance, leading to dry eye symptoms.According to a study published in the American Journal of Ophthalmology, MGD is present in approximately 86% of patients with dry eye syndrome

(1).

One key factor that contributes to MGD is altered blink behavior.

The Role of Blink Rate in Dry Eye Symptoms

Blink rate has been found to play a significant role in dry eye discomfort. In general, people with dry eye syndrome tend to have a lower blink rate than those without the condition. This reduced blink rate can lead to evaporation of tears, causing further irritation and discomfort.Research has shown that a lower blink rate is associated with increased tear evaporation, which can exacerbate dry eye symptoms

(2).

Conversely, increasing the blink rate can help to reduce tear evaporation and alleviate dry eye symptoms.

Exploring Natural Preservatives in Good Drops for Dry Eyes

Good drops for dry eyes

Preservatives play a crucial role in maintaining the quality and safety of Good Drops for dry eyes by preventing the growth of bacteria and other microorganisms. However, some conventional preservatives in eye drops can cause irritation, discomfort, or even exacerbate dry eye symptoms. This section delves into the world of natural preservatives and explores the benefits and efficacy of alternative solutions.Conventional preservatives, such as benzalkonium chloride (BAK), have been widely used in eye drops to prevent contamination.

While they are effective, BAK has been linked to several issues, including:

  • Eye irritation: BAK can cause eye redness, itching, and irritation, which can be particularly problematic for individuals with dry eyes.
  • Corneal toxicity: Prolonged exposure to BAK has been shown to damage the cornea and lead to vision problems.
  • Increased risk of infection: BAK-resistant bacteria can develop, making them more challenging to treat.

User Queries

Q: What are the causes of dry eyes?

A: Dry eyes can be caused by a variety of factors, including environmental conditions, certain medications, age, and blinking disorders.

Q: What are the symptoms of dry eyes?

A: Symptoms of dry eyes include blurred vision, eye redness, grittiness, and a sensation of something being stuck in the eye.

Q: Can I treat dry eyes at home?

A: Yes, there are several at-home remedies for dry eyes, including using artificial tears, humidifying your surroundings, and avoiding irritants such as smoke and wind.

Q: Are there any risks associated with using good drops for dry eyes?

A: While good drops for dry eyes are generally safe, there are some potential risks to be aware of, including eye irritation, allergic reactions, and interactions with other medications.

Q: Can I use good drops for dry eyes if I have a condition such as diabetes or keratoconus?

A: It’s essential to consult with your eye doctor before using good drops for dry eyes, especially if you have a pre-existing condition such as diabetes or keratoconus.
